Finally we got together to try this place. The parking lot is huge - it is not by the gas station but in the back of the restaurant. There are multiple entrances, one for the bar, and one for the restaurant. We were seated in the dining area. The service was quick. We got octopus and meatballs as appetizers. I loved the octopus. The sauce in the dish tasted so perfect. We got complimentary salad for the entrees we ordered, and the balsamic vinegar tasted great - not syrupy at all. I had the angel hair with lobster and shrimp in garlic oil ($35). Every ingredient tasted fresh, and the sauce again was so delicious. My husband had fettuccini carbonara ($16) with added chicken ($5), and he was very happy about the fact that the carbonara was not salty. With the bacon bits, his paste tasted perfectly balanced. Our friend ordered the eggplant parmigiana with Penny Vodka ($18). He packed almost the whole dish home after trying very hard to finish, and he said he felt extremely full. We loved the complimentary bread - they were essentials to the dishes! For the quality and quantity, I am very impressed by their affordable price. We will come back again - we wanted to try their pizza next time!

Stopped by with the family for dinner. Nice people, service was good. Pizza is the thing to get here. We had the calamari appetizer, which was delicious. Cacio e Pepe for my entree, was more like garlic and oil. Prosciutto pizza was not to my liking. My wife had a Caesar salad with shrimp. The salad was drenched in dressing and the shrimp were very salty. We were a bit disappointed with the food. This place is just starting out, and the pizza was very good except for the prosciutto. We will probably give it another shot.

I had never before been to Angelina's. I went for a birthday party. The female bartender was prompt, pleasant, and very accommodating as she explained that almost anything on the menu could be modified to my liking. Once in the back room party area the servers were equally as prompt, pleasant and accommodating. My beer glass was kept full and my pizza, kind of a special off menu order, was really good. I will probably never be back to Angelina's, as I live over an hour away, but my one visit was very good all the way around.
